so... here is how it works FOR ME...

My camera has this red led blinking when it's working...
and when you connect it with the pc... well it has to work...

Now i waited until it stops blinking and pressed "Import photos" then...
and... here we go... it works!

So maybe you should do it like... the driver needs some time to load... so give 
it that time...
and when the driver is loaded start gthumb...
hope it works for you other guys too.
